Below is the info I already know. Two variable power rifle scopes The both hold zero on my 243 and 223 so must be of some quality. PO 3-9x39 and PO 3-9x40 for standard 1" mounts . Scope1 Scope #1: 3-9x40 - made by "Arsenal", Kiev, Ukraine somewhere in 90's. Has fine crosshair reticule, variable power from 3 till 9 and blue-tinted color lenses for visual performance enhancement. Can be mounted on standard 1" mount rings. Scope #2: 3-9x39 - made by "ZOMZ", (Zagorskij optiko-mehanicheskij zavod - Zagorsk, Russia somewhere in 90's. ZOMZ is famous for their military optics for Soviet and now Russian army. Has classic German #1 crosshair reticule, variable power from 3 till 9 and blue-tinted color lenses for visual performance enhancement. Can be mounted on standard 1" mount rings. Thanks in advance.
